McCaysville is a city in Georgia's Northeast High Country. McCaysville, Georgia and Copperhill, Tennessee are known as "twin cities" as the Georgia and Tennessee state lines separate the two cities.

Belltown is an unincorporated community in Polk County, in the U.S. state of Tennessee. A large share of Belltown's original inhabitants had the surname Bell, hence the name. Belltown is situated 4½ miles northeast of Mobile Mine.
